## Configuration

Hey on-call folks — the FuelScope nightly report pulls odometer and pump data from the Vantry fleet API. Most defaults are fine; just set `FUEL_REPORT_REGION` and `FLEET_DEPOT_CODE` in your `.env` before running. One more thing: the report job needs the Vantry read token, so add this line to your `.env`:

sealed setting: VAULT_KEY5=54f99

Ticket: Config drift on Prunebot staging

While reviewing the stale-branch cleanup bot, I noticed staging has drifted from the committed config: the grace period was manually shortened and the dry-run flag disabled, which explains branches being deleted after only two days. Please review carefully, since this affects repository data. The values currently live on the staging host are these.

deployment values, yadug-bawif:
[framir]
team = pelox
access_code = ac_a38ab2
owner = tamion.julael
host = framir.tolvaqlabs.test
port = 11211
peer = tammir.zemvargrid.local
salt = 2215ef03
pin = 1541

Ticket: GateTally turnstile counter — staging env misconfigured.

Staging instance of GateTally at the Harrowfield Arena pilot is reporting zero entries. Root cause: env file was regenerated without the telemetry uplink credential, so counts never post upstream. Non-sensitive vars (`GATE_ZONE`, `TALLY_INTERVAL`) verified correct. Fix requires restoring one line to `/opt/gatetally/.env`. The missing line that sets the uplink secret is:

sealed setting: LEDGER_TOKEN5=bcca1